Isle of Man should consider decriminalising, says Chief Minister Allan Bell

The Chief Minister of the Isle of Man has said wants to widen the debate on drugs, by considering decriminalising cannabis on the island.

Allan Bell’s comments follow a presentation on the island given by former Westminster drugs adviser Professor David Nutt, who was sacked under Labour after he criticised stricter laws on cannabis.

Most recently, Professor Nutt said the number of deaths from so-called legal highs are overestimated, arguing that drugs are often wrongly classified or already outlawed in the UK.

During his speech, Professor Nutt suggested that by relaxing laws, the self-governing Crown dependency could become a research hub for exploring the medical benefits of drugs, the Isle of Man Examiner reported.

In an interview with the newspaper, Mr Bell praised Professor Nutt’s “fresh perspective” on the drugs debate.

Accepting the link between cannabis and mental health problems, Mr Bell told reporters it was also important to consider evidence which suggests that it has positive effects on a range of medical conditions.
